I might be wrong, but don’t you have to be Catholic to get married in a Catholic church. He might not be Catholic now, but is it safe to assume that he was when they married?
You need to be baptized, generally speaking. You can be Christian of any denomination and agree to raise your kids Catholic, but generally speaking, non-Christians can’t be married in the Catholic church. From what little I know of hospice–it is not set up for such acute interventions as correcting electrolyte imbalances etc.
Keep in mind–this is a hospice. People are supposed to die there. I doubt that there is even a crash cart for the pts (there may be one for staff or visitors–I am not up on the state’s requirements on these things). They may only have those defib machines, like at the airport. And if there is a pharmacy on site, there may be no potassium/magnesium etc.
I doubt there is a bag of IV fluid in the whole place, except on the crash cart(if any).
